GE214LD
Large Diameter quartz tubes used by the semiconductor, fiber optic and related industries, for their purity, sag resistance, low OH (hydroxyl), low alkali and excellent physical characteristics.
GE214LD is a natural quartz grade, which is also available as GE214LDA "low hydroxyl", GE224LD "low alkali" and GE244LD "low aluminum / low alkali" variants.

(ppm by weight, analysis via direct spectrometer reading)
Type | Al | As | B | Ca | Cd | Cr | Cu | Fe | K | Li | Mg | Mn | Na | Ni | p | Sb | Ti | Zr | *OH |
---|---|---|---|---|---|---|---|---|---|---|---|---|---|---|---|---|---|---|---|
GE214LD | 14 | <0.002 | <0.2 | 0.4 | <0.01 | <0.05 | <0.05 | 0.2 | 0.6 | 0.6 | 0.1 | <0.05 | 0.7 | <0.1 | <0.2 | <0.003 | 1.1 | 0.8 | 10 |
GE214LDA | 14 | <0.002 | <0.2 | 0.4 | <0.01 | <0.05 | <0.05 | 0.2 | 0.6 | 0.6 | 0.1 | <0.05 | 0.7 | <0.1 | <0.2 | <0.003 | 1.1 | 0.8 | 5 |
GE224LD | 14 | <0.002 | <0.2 | 0.4 | <0.01 | <0.05 | <0.01 | 0.2 | <0.2 | 0.001 | 0.1 | <0.05 | <0.1 | <0.1 | <0.2 | 0.003 | 1.1 | 0.8 | 10 |
GE244LD | 8 | <0.002 | <0.1 | 0.6 | <O.01 | <0.05 | <0.01 | 0.2 | <0.2 | 0.001 | <0.1 | <0.03 | 0.1 | <0.1 | <0.2 | <0.003 | 1.4 | 0.3 | 10 |
Mechanical | |
---|---|
Density | 2,2 x 103 kg/m3 |
Mohs hardness | 5,5 - 6,5 |
Design Tensile Strength | 4,8 x 107 Pa |
Compressive Strength | >1,1 x 109 Pa |
Bulk Modulus | 3,7 x 1010 Pa |
Rigidity Modulus | 3,1 x 1010 Pa |
Young's Modulus | 7,2 x 1010 Pa |
Poisson's Ratio | 0,17 |
Thermal | |
Coeff. of exp (20 - 320 °C) | 5,5 x 10-7 cm/cm * °C |
Thermal Conductivity (20°C) | 1,4 W/m * °C |
Specific Heat (20 °C) | 670 J/kg * °C |
Softening Point | 1683°C |
Annealing Point | 1215°C |
Strain Point | 1120 °C |
Electrical | |
Electrical Resistivity (350 °C) | 7 x 107 cm*Ω |
Dielectric Constant (20 °C, 1MHz) | 3,75 |
Dielectric Strength (20°C, 1MHz) | 5 x 107 V/m |
Dielectric Loss Factor (20 °C, 1MHz) | < 4x10-4 |
Dissipation Factor (20 °C, 1MHz) | < 1x10-4 |
